Eastern Shore Art Center welcomes all new exhibits, including two centered around our great Gulf Coast!

 

WHAT:

  • NEW EXHIBIT: “Colors of Spanish New Mexico” Traditional weaving by Don Sandoval. Don is (at least) a fifth generation weaver. He comes from a family rich in the New Mexico Spanish arts and crafts traditions. He works mainly in the Rio Grande style traditions of his ancestors, using hand-dyed (natural and chemical) churro wool yarn. Don creates tapestries by blending the three styles for his own interpretation of the Rio Grande style, as well as contemporary style tapestries.
  • NEW EXHIBIT: “Beachcombing: Impressions of the Gulf Coast”. Paintings by Theresa Grillo Laird. “This exhibit was inspired by the earnest effort to understand a landscape foreign to my northern roots. From Perdido Key to Rosemary Beach, and Pensacola to Bagdad, I carried my painting gear through dunes, over beaches and to the marshes that give the coast it’s character.”
  • NEW EXHIBIT: “Gulf of America” Watercolors by Herb Willey. “For the last 3 years I have devoted my time to painting life on a small portion of the Gulf Coast but now have expanded the entirety of the Gulf Coast. My paintings include aspects of dealing with life or everyday moments that an audience can bring back to life in their own way. Like Picasso, ‘I’m not afraid to paint what I see.’”
